Celebrating Jubilee 

The Jubilee 2025 is a special holy year in Rome and the Vatican City, and across Italy and the world,  it began on Christmas eve 2024 and ending on the 6th of January (Epiphany) 2026. A Jubilee year is a time for celebration, it sees millions of pilgrims visiting Rome seeking spiritual renewal and a stronger connection to their faith
